Induction hobs heat your pans via electromagnets. They're more energy efficient than other kinds of stovetops. They also come with the bonus of only heating the pans when you're making use of them, and they turn off automatically once you've finished cooking. However, you must ensure that you select the correct pans for your stove. Cast iron and steel are great, but aluminium and copper pans with magnetic bases also work with an induction hob.

You can choose between electric and gas models when you are looking for a single oven with a hob. Electric cookers have an electric hob that could be made of ceramic, induction or solid sealed plates. They also have an air conditioner to ensure that heat from the oven is distributed evenly. This can mean that an electric cooker will take longer to reach the ideal temperature than a gas model however, it offers greater control over the heating process and often comes with a variety of functions like a built in single gas oven with gas grill-in timer and self-clean functions.
Gas cookers on the other hand offer instant heat with precise control of the temperature of your food. You can select from a wide range of burners that will match your cooking needs. Some models include a grill above the hob to increase functionality. This type of cooker will suit those who prefer cooking using traditional methods or the smoky flavor of gas.
